Grove Road is in Richmond and in Richmond Upon Thames district. TW10 6SW is located in the South Richmond elect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Richmond Park. This postcode has been in use since 1995-01-01.

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.
In the area around TW10 6SW this area, 9.6%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ly lower than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its high percentage of residents with higher education degree or similar.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 59%.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| No qualifications | 9.4% | 9.6% | 0.2% | 18.2% | -8.6% |
| 1-4 GCSEs or Equivalent | 7.8% | 7.9% | 0.1% | 9.6% | -1.7% |
| 5 or more GCSEs, an A-Level or 1-2 AS Levels | 9.4% | 6.2% | -3.2% | 13.4% | -7.2% |
| Apprenticeship | 0.6% | 2.8% | 2.2% | 5.3% | -2.5% |
| HNC, HND or 2+ A Levels | 10% | 9.6% | -0.4% | 16.9% | -7.3% |
| Degree or Similar | 51.7% | 59% | 7.3% | 33.8% | 25.2% |
| Other | 11.1% | 5.1% | -6.0% | 2.8% | 2.3%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Grove Road was 161.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 119.1% higher than the East Sheen average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.
Grove Road has the 5th highest crime rate of 68 local areas in East Sheen and the 54th highest crime rate of 595 local areas in Richmond upon Thames .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 38.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 27.6%.
